⭐Pixel Flow Level 2383 - Complete Walkthrough Guide

Level 2383 in Pixel Flow is one of those puzzles that really tests your patience and planning skills. You’re dealing with 8 different colors, each needing its own path from start to finish. The grid is packed, and the routes cross over, so you have to be extra careful not to block yourself. I found this level takes about 20 to 30 minutes if you’re deliberate but not stuck. It’s a true brain teaser that rewards careful pattern recognition.

Step-by-Step Solution

Step 1: Color Strategy - Before you even start drawing paths, take a moment to decide the order in which you’ll connect the colors. It’s tempting to jump right in, but trust me, picking which color to tackle first can save a lot of headaches later. I usually pick the color with the longest or most complicated path first because it’s the hardest to fit in once the board gets busy.

Step 2: First Color - Connect the first color pair you chose, ideally the one with the longest path. This sets the foundation. For example, if the red pixels are at opposite corners, start there. Mapping this out early clears up space and mentally frames the rest of the puzzle.

Step 3: Subsequent Colors - Now, add the other colors one by one. Keep a logical sequence in mind—don’t just pick colors at random. Think about how each new path will fit around the ones you’ve already laid down. It’s a bit like fitting puzzle pieces; you want to avoid forcing a path that blocks future moves.

Step 4: Space Utilization - Be mindful of how you use the grid space. This is crucial because inefficient routes can leave you trapped later. I often remind myself to use the shortest possible path without cutting corners that restrict options. Sometimes it’s better to take a slightly longer route if it keeps other paths open.

Step 5: Final Review - When you’ve connected all colors, take a close look at the entire board. Every pixel should have a smooth, uninterrupted path to its matching endpoint. If you spot any gaps or overlaps, backtrack a bit. This review helps catch small errors before you finish.

Pro Tips & Strategies

Analysis Tip 1: Pre-Game Analysis - Spend a few moments scanning the board before making your first move. Identify the tricky colors and potential bottlenecks. This mental map guides your entire approach.

Analysis Tip 2: Mid-Game Analysis - Don’t be afraid to pause and reassess once you’ve connected a few colors. Sometimes you’ll realize a path you chose earlier is blocking a better route for another color.

Analysis Tip 3: Post-Move Analysis - After each connection, think about how it affects the remaining colors. Does this path open up new possibilities or create dead ends? This habit keeps you flexible.

Analysis Tip 4: Post-Game Analysis - After finishing, reflect on what worked and what didn’t. Maybe a path was too tight or you struggled with a particular color. Learning from each attempt sharpens your skills.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Failure Point 1: Mid-Puzzle Chaos - If you find yourself stuck halfway with no clear moves, it usually means the initial color order wasn’t well planned. Don’t rush the start!

Failure Point 2: Last Pixel Trap - Getting stuck with one pixel that just won’t connect at the end is frustrating. This almost always means earlier paths boxed it in. Think ahead to avoid this trap.

Failure Point 3: Space Shortage - Running out of space before finishing all connections is a sign you didn’t manage the grid well. Prioritize efficient routes and keep options open.

Failure Point 4: Repeated Failures - If you keep failing the same puzzle without changing your approach, it’s time to rethink your strategy. Adaptation is key.
